Understanding Rental Policies and Requirements

When it comes to⁣ renting⁤ a vehicle, understanding ⁣the policies⁣ and requirements significantly​ enhances your ‌experience. Rental companies typically have specific criteria that need to be met⁣ before you ‌can drive off in your chosen car. ⁤These criteria often include ​age restrictions, a‌ valid⁢ driver’s license, proof of insurance, and ⁣a‌ credit ‌card for the security‍ deposit. Here’s what‍ you⁢ should keep an‍ eye on:

  • Age Requirements: Most ​companies require renters‍ to be at least 21 years old, ‍though some may impose additional ⁣fees ⁢for⁤ younger⁣ drivers.
  • Identification: ‌ A valid driver’s license is mandatory, ⁣and international travelers might need an International Driving‌ Permit.
  • Insurance Information: It’s advisable​ to check whether your⁢ personal⁤ or credit card insurance ‍covers ​rental ​cars to avoid ⁢duplicate insurance purchase.
  • Payment Method: ⁤A credit card is⁣ typically required, although some companies⁣ may accept debit cards ​with ‍certain ⁤conditions.

Additionally, rental policies‍ often⁣ cover other‌ important aspects⁣ such as fuel requirements, mileage‍ limits, and additional driver fees. Understanding⁢ these terms can save ⁢you from unexpected‍ charges. It’s essential to familiarize yourself with these policies, as they​ can differ vastly from one provider to another.‌ Below is a ⁤brief overview ⁣of common rental policies:

PolicyDescription
Fuel PolicyReturn the⁣ car with ⁤the same amount of fuel ⁣as when picked⁣ up to avoid ⁤extra charges.
Mileage ‌LimitSome rentals include unlimited mileage; others may charge per mile after a limit.
Additional DriversMost companies charge a fee for ‍adding ⁢extra drivers; make sure they are listed on the contract.

Choosing the Right Vehicle for Your Needs

When selecting a vehicle ‌for ⁣your ⁢rental ​needs, it’s essential⁤ to consider several factors that align ​with your specific requirements. First,​ think about ⁢the purpose of ⁤your rental. ​Are you planning a family road trip, a⁣ solo business ⁤trip, or ⁤perhaps a ⁢weekend getaway ‍with⁣ friends? Each scenario demands different qualities in a vehicle. For family trips, ⁤you might prefer spacious SUVs or ​minivans, while agile sedans or compact ​cars ​could be more suitable⁢ for solo journeys. ⁤ Also ‍consider the terrain: will you be driving in the city ⁢or heading off the beaten path? A sturdy four-wheel drive may be‌ essential if ​your plans include ⁤rugged trails.

Moreover,‌ understanding your budget is critical in making the right choice. Break‌ down your costs by considering the daily rental ​price, fuel efficiency,‌ and any additional fees​ such as insurance or roadside assistance. This ​way, ⁣you’ll be⁣ equipped to avoid unexpected ⁤expenses‍ and ⁣choose a vehicle that⁢ provides both ⁣comfort and ‌functionality. Here’s ‍a quick overview to guide your decision:

Vehicle TypeBest ForAverage Price Range
SedanBusiness trips,‍ city driving$30-$50/day
SUVFamily ‌trips, off-road$50-$80/day
ConvertibleLeisure trips, special occasions$70-$120/day
MinivanLarge groups, ⁣family travel$60-$90/day

When it comes⁣ to renting a​ car, understanding​ the various insurance options available can ⁤be​ a daunting task. Rental companies ​typically offer a range of coverage options you can choose from, each designed to protect you in different scenarios. Consider these common ⁢types of insurance:

  • Collision Damage Waiver (CDW): ⁤Covers the cost of damages to the⁤ rental car⁤ in the event​ of​ an accident.
  • Liability Insurance: Protects you against damages you may cause to others or their​ property.
  • Personal ⁣Accident Insurance: Offers coverage for medical expenses resulting from an accident.
  • Personal ‌Effects‌ Coverage: Insures against theft of personal items from the vehicle.

Before making a decision, it’s wise to check your personal ⁤auto ‌insurance policy and credit‌ card benefits, ​as many provide ‌rental coverage ‌that ‌may suffice. ‍When evaluating your options, you ‍might⁢ find it⁤ helpful to compare ​the coverage levels ⁢and deductibles. The following table outlines key⁣ differences between typical coverage types offered ‍by rental ⁢agencies:

Coverage TypeWhat It CoversTypical Daily⁢ Rate
CDWAccident damage to the rental car$10 ⁢- $30
Liability InsuranceDamages to third‌ parties$15 – ⁤$25
Personal Accident InsuranceMedical costs for you and your‌ passengers$5 ‌- $10
Personal Effects CoverageTheft of belongings from the car$3 – $7

Tips for Saving Money on Your Car⁣ Rental

Finding ways to save money on⁣ your car rental can help you make the most out of your travel ⁢budget. To start, always compare prices‌ across different rental companies using websites or apps dedicated to aggregating rental offers.⁣ Additionally, consider booking⁤ your rental in advance,⁤ as⁢ this often results in lower rates. Many companies⁣ offer discounts for early bookings, which can further enhance your savings.

Another effective strategy is to avoid unnecessary add-ons that rental companies frequently push. For⁣ instance, insurance coverage may already be included in your personal car insurance‌ or credit⁣ card benefits, so ⁣always check before committing to additional plans. Furthermore,⁤ opt ‍for a vehicle that fits ‍your needs rather than⁣ the latest luxury model; ​smaller cars⁢ typically have lower rental rates and greater ⁢fuel efficiency. Lastly,⁣ don’t‍ forget to‍ return the car with a full tank to⁣ avoid extra‍ refueling charges,⁢ which can ​significantly inflate your overall rental cost.

Q1: ​What documents do I need to rent a car?

A1: To rent a car,⁢ you typically need‌ a valid driver’s license, a credit⁢ card in your name, and a minimum age requirement that varies by rental company (usually 21 years old). Some‍ companies may​ require additional identification or proof of‍ insurance, especially for those‍ under 25. Always check the specific ‌requirements​ of the rental agency before your trip.


Q2: What is‍ the best way to compare rental car rates?

A2: The most effective way ​to compare‍ rental car rates is to use online travel⁤ agencies or aggregator websites. These platforms allow you⁤ to input your travel‌ dates and location, ⁤so they can show rates from multiple rental companies. Additionally, consider checking ‌the rental ⁢agencies’ own websites‍ for exclusive ⁣deals, ⁢and remember to read‌ the terms ⁤and conditions carefully to understand what each rate ‍includes.


Q3: Are there any hidden fees associated with renting a car?

A3:‍ Yes, many⁢ car rental companies may have hidden ⁤fees that can significantly ‍increase the total cost of​ your rental. ‌Common additional fees include airport surcharges, ​fuel charges for not returning the vehicle with a full ​tank, and fees for additional drivers or young‌ driver surcharges. ⁤To avoid surprises, review the rental agreement ⁣thoroughly and ask the rental company for a breakdown ⁣of all‍ fees.


Q4: What kind of‌ insurance do I need when renting a car?

A4: When renting⁣ a car, you ⁤generally have three options⁣ for ⁤insurance: personal car insurance, credit card ‍insurance,⁤ and rental company insurance.⁤ Check if ⁣your existing auto insurance policy covers rental ⁤cars and‍ confirm⁤ if your‌ credit card‍ provides rental car insurance as ⁢a benefit. If not, consider purchasing⁣ coverage ‍from the rental company, but be sure‌ to assess the costs and coverage limits.


Q5: Can I rent a car ⁢without ⁤a ‍credit‌ card?

A5: While it is possible to rent a car without a credit⁤ card, it ⁤can be challenging. Most rental companies require a credit card ‌as a ‌security deposit. Some may ⁣accept debit cards, ⁣but they may impose more⁤ stringent requirements, such as ​a credit check‍ or⁢ additional verification.⁢ It’s crucial to check the specific policies of ‌the rental ⁣company in⁣ advance if you plan to use a‌ debit card.


Q6: ⁣What should I do if ​I have a problem with my‌ rental car?

A6: If‍ you experience any issues with your rental ⁤car,⁤ such as mechanical ⁣problems or accidents, contact the rental‍ company immediately. They typically provide a roadside assistance service and will guide you on the⁤ necessary steps.‍ Ensure you keep ⁣all‍ documentation, including rental agreements and​ communication, for clarification and follow-up.


Q7: ​How can I ensure I get the best car for my ⁣needs?

A7: To secure‍ the best ​rental car ⁢for your⁤ needs, consider your⁢ travel ⁣requirements, ⁣such as passenger ⁤capacity,⁣ luggage space, and fuel efficiency. ⁢Additionally, selecting the right vehicle class⁢ can enhance your comfort and convenience. It’s advisable⁣ to book in advance to increase your options​ and‌ check for⁣ any special‍ requests, like ‍GPS or​ child⁢ seats, when making ​your reservation.


Q8: What⁣ are the⁤ terms for‍ returning the⁢ rental car?

A8: ⁣Return ⁢policies can vary by rental ⁤company. Most require the car to be returned with a full⁢ tank to avoid refueling charges. ​Additionally,⁢ cars usually ⁤need ‍to⁤ be returned by 24 ⁤hours after the⁣ specified time to avoid extra daily fees. Check the rental agreement for exact return timing, location, and any penalties for ‍late returns.


Q9:⁢ Is it possible⁤ to extend my rental period?

A9: Yes, you can usually extend your rental period ​by contacting the rental company directly. However, be aware that extending ⁤your rental may change​ your rate, and ​availability may vary based​ on demand. It is advisable⁤ to handle extensions before your original return time to‍ avoid any complications.


Q10: What are the benefits‌ of booking a ​rental car in advance?

A10: Booking a rental car in advance can provide several advantages, including better rates,‍ guaranteed availability, and the ⁣ability ⁢to choose from a wider selection ‍of vehicles.⁣ Early booking also allows you to take ​advantage of promotions⁤ or ‍discounts that may not be available ‍closer to your travel ‌dates. To⁣ maximize savings, make your reservation as soon as your travel ⁤plans are confirmed.
